Similar to a home mortgage, with a residence equity car loan you'll receive a round figure of money at once as well as you'll be billed interest over a dealt with settlement period. When you get a home equity lending, the lender will identify just how much you certify to borrow based upon numerous aspects, including exactly how a lot equity you have in your residence. Your equity is figured by deducting how much you still owe on your home loan from the market worth of your house. You're commonly restricted to obtaining an amount equivalent to 85% or much less of the equity in your house.

What Is a Home improvement loan & exactly How Do They function?

Your loan provider will likely determine the amount of the car loan based on the future worth of the remodelled property. Well, you can obtain a lot more since you might receive a larger car loan than you might if the computation were based on the home's pre-renovation worth. This likewise has a tendency to imply that you do not have to stress over the current problem of the home; with some other types of funding, the loan provider may balk if the property is in disarray.

Is it hard to get approved for a home equity loan?

To qualify for a home equity loan, here are some minimum requirements: Your credit score is 620 or higher. A score of 700 and above will most likely qualify for the best rates. You have a maximum loan-to-value ratio, or LTV, of 80 percent — or 20 percent equity in your home.

What is the interest rate on a renovation loan?

Average home improvement loan rates currently range from around 5.99 percent to around 36 percent. While the rate you're quoted depends on many factors, the most important is usually your credit score; the higher your credit score, the lower your rate.

VA financings and VA rehabilitation or restoration fundings are basically the same item. The only genuine distinction is that the VA rehab financing is marked "for modification as well as repair" of a residence. In contrast, conventional VA car loans are merely a residence acquisition or re-finance item.
